Tannoy CMS 503 Overview

This pair of 5" Full-Range Ceiling Loudspeaker from Tannoy includes two wide-bandwidth, high-power handling, and high-sensitivity loudspeakers built around Tannoy's CMS 3.0 Ceiling Monitor System technology. This speaker has been re-engineered for optimum compatibility with Lab.gruppen commercial amplifiers while also delivering consistent broadband directivity, precise articulation for voice and music, and long-term reliability in installation applications.

The point-source configuration of the ICT driver's mid-bass and tweeter sections ensures a wide and controlled dispersion for optimum coverage, avoiding the significant energy losses in the vertical plane at the crossover frequency that are inherent in typical two-way designs. The ICT (Inductive Coupling Technology) drive unit also addresses two common component failures in background music systems: the tweeter and the crossover. Use of wireless electromagnetic coupling to drive the tweeter means that no crossover is required, making the ICT drive unit exceptionally reliable and ideal for applications where constant heavy usage is the norm. The mineral-loaded polypropylene cone material and nitrile rubber surround further enhance durability and long-term reliability.

The loudspeaker utilizes a 16-Ohm driver, making it ideal for use in high-performance, low-impedance systems. A low insertion-loss 30W transformer is included, with convenient front switching for taps at 30W, 15W, and 7.5W, with an additional 3.75W tap for traditional constant voltage systems. An extra clamp extension accommodates thicker ceiling panels, and a locking design prevents inadvertent over-screwing. The magnetic grille attachment enables easy removal and fitting for custom painting and tapping changes.

Each speaker includes a grille, two tile support rails, and a C-ring. This pre-install model is supplied without a backcan.

Tannoy CMS 503 Specs

Low Frequency Driver
5" / 130 mm mineral loaded polypropylene
High Frequency Driver
ICT aluminum dome
Frequency Range
71 Hz to 24 kHz at -10 dB
System Sensitivity
89 dB (1 W = 4 V for 16 Ohms)
Nominal Coverage Angle
90°
Coverage Angle
105°, 1 to 6 kHz
Directivity Factor
5.6 averaged, 1 to 6 kHz
Directivity Index
7.0 averaged, 1 to 6 kHz
Power Handling
Average: 50 W
Program: 100 W
Peak: 200 W
Recommended Amplifier Power
100 W @ 16 Ohms
Nominal Impedance
16 Ohms
Maximum SPL
Average: 106 dB
Peak: 112 dB
Transformer Taps
70 V: 30 W (165 Ohms), 15 W (330 Ohms), 7.5 W (660 Ohms), 3.75 W (1320 Ohms), OFF & low impedance operation
100 V: 30 W (330 Ohms), 15 W (660 Ohms), 7.5 W (1320 Ohms), OFF & low impedance
Crossover
7 kHz inductively coupled
Enclosure
Baffle: Reflex loaded UL 94V-0 rated ABS
Grille: Steel, with weather resistant coating
Safety Features
Safety ring located at rear of enclosure for load bearing safety bond
Clamping Characteristics
Security toggle clamp
Clamping Range: 0.37 - 2.36" / 1 - 6 cm
Recommended Clamp Torque: 1.5 Nm
Mount
Separate back can for pre-installation
Cable Entry
Cable clamp & squeeze connector for conduit up to 0.9" / 22 mm
Conduit
Conduit Knockouts on PI Backcan
Three Sets of Horizontal Positions: 0.75" / 19 mm,  0.87" / 22 mm, and 1.10" / 28 mm
Connectors
Removable locking screw terminals with "loop thru"
Compliance
UL-1480, UL-2043, CE
Dimensions
Bezel Diameter: 8.11" / 20.6 cm
Front of Ceiling to Rear of Speaker Unit: 5.2" / 13.2 cm
Front of Accessory Back Can Bezel to Top of Safety Loop: 6.0" / 15.4 cm
Hole Cutout Diameter: 7.5" / 19 cm
Weight
6.3 lb / 2.9 kg
